KAREN COLE SMITH

Senior Litigation | Trial Paralegal

Karen Smith is a senior litigation/trial paralegal with Amy Stewart PC. She has 21 years of experience in legal support roles for both large and small law firms in Texas and Virginia.

Approaching every matter with a fresh perspective and independent insight, Karen applies her comprehensive litigation background to add value to every case that she supports. Karen's tasks include conducting legal research, business research, document production, drafting discovery, drafting memoranda, agreements and other documents, managing case files, and assisting in trial preparation.

Before joining Amy Stewart PC, Karen was a litigation paralegal at a large international full-service law firm. She has worked at firms specializing in commercial litigation, insurance litigation, bankruptcy, professional liability, and corporate and securities lawsuits. PROFESSIONAL & COMMUNITY INVOLVEMENT

Karen is an active and committed member of the paralegal community, where she has held a number of leadership roles over the years. She is a member of the Paralegal Division of the State Bar of Texas, and recently served as the CLE Sub-Chair (Dallas District). Karen was previously the Committee Sub-Chair for the Professional Development Committee. She is also a member of the College of the State Bar of Texas and the National Association of Legal Assistants.

Karen is on the Board of Directors and is President-Elect (2012) of the Dallas Area Paralegal Association (DAPA), and she currently serves as DAPA's Education Vice President and Entertainment Chair. In 2010, she received the Dallas Area Paralegal Association Volunteer of the Year Award.

She is also a member of the Junior League of Dallas.
